AdventHealth Heart of Florida

This 14,700-square-foot lobby renovation and 10-bed emergency department expansion for Heart of Florida is part of a nine-phase project renovating and expanding the front of the hospital. The project consisted of constructing a new registration area, partial demolition of the existing emergency department, and complete finish upgrade for all public areas of the first floor.

The Nuclear Medicine renovation for Heart of Florida is a 523-square-foot, two-phase project for the installation of new Nuclear Medicine Equipment. The first phase includes the relocation of the hot lab to allow the facility to remain fully operational throughout the project. The second phase of the project is the complete renovation of the nuclear med room.
